Case Study – Replacing a Legacy Software System

In 2015, BSPOKE Software launched Job Costing for Leicester City Council’s Highways Department. This system manages all aspects of road construction and maintenance, tracking job income and expenses to ensure efficient work allocation across the city. It also integrates with other software developed by BSPOKE, marking a major step in replacing a legacy software system.

Bespoke Software Development an Introduction

Bespoke software development is the creation of custom-built software designed to meet your specific needs. In contrast to off-the-shelf software, which is made for the general public and comes with broad, generic features, bespoke software is specifically tailored to address the unique challenges and requirements of your business.
